HOW 55 Cases PLAYED OUT
The Daily News reviewed disciplinary decisions against 55 NYPD officers between July 22 and Sept. 29, 2017. Of those officers: One was fired.
10 were placed on one-year “dismissal probation,” on top of suspensions and a loss of vacation days, for a variety of charges ranging from overtime theft to assaulting another officer while on duty.
30 were docked between 10 and 45 vacation days. Of those, eight were docked 10 days, nine 15 days and seven 20 days. Six served suspensions ranging from 20 to 33 days. Two were found not guilty of all departmental charges.
Six saw their departmental charges dismissed, though two of those still lost a small number of vacation days.
